Nutritional Benefits


Sunflower seed kernels, the edible part of sunflower seeds, are packed with essential nutrients. They are an excellent source of vitamin E, B vitamins, magnesium, and selenium, contributing to a well-rounded diet. Moreover, sunflower seeds are rich in healthy fats, particularly polyunsaturated and monounsaturated fats, which are known to promote heart health. For cake factories, this offers an opportunity to create healthier dessert options that appeal to health-conscious consumers. Adding sunflower seed kernels to cakes not only enhances their nutritional profile but also aligns with the growing trend of “better-for-you” baked goods.


Unique Flavor and Texture


Incorporating sunflower seed kernels into cake recipes introduces a unique, nutty flavor that can elevate the overall taste of the product. This distinct flavor can complement various cake types, from chocolate and vanilla to more exotic flavors like matcha or turmeric. The crunchy texture of sunflower seed kernels provides a delightful contrast to the softness of cake, enhancing the overall eating experience. Cake factories can experiment with different quantities of sunflower seed kernels to discover the perfect balance that caters to diverse consumer palates.

Sunflower seed kernels are remarkably versatile, making them suitable for a wide range of cake products. Whether used as a main ingredient or a decorative topping, these kernels can enhance both the visual appeal and the taste of cakes. They can be mixed into the batter, sprinkled on top, or even used in frosting. This versatility allows manufacturers to innovate and create a line of sunflower seed kernel-infused cakes, such as sunflower chocolate cake, carrot cake topped with sunflower seeds, or even raw cakes that appeal to vegans and those seeking plant-based options.


Catering to Dietary Preferences


As dietary preferences evolve, cake factories face the challenge of catering to a diverse consumer base. The incorporation of sunflower seed kernels can address various dietary needs, including gluten-free and nut-free diets. Since sunflower seed kernels are naturally gluten-free, they can be an excellent alternative for those who cannot consume wheat products. Additionally, sunflower seeds are a wonderful substitute for tree nuts, making cakes that feature these kernels accessible to individuals with nut allergies. This inclusive approach can broaden a factory’s customer base and foster brand loyalty among consumers with specific dietary restrictions.


Sustainability Considerations


With increasing awareness of environmental issues, sustainability has become a key concern for many consumers. Sunflowers are relatively easy to cultivate and require less water and fewer chemicals than other crops. Utilizing sunflower seeds in cake production can appeal to environmentally conscious consumers who appreciate sustainable practices in food production. By opting for local or sustainably sourced sunflower seed kernels, cake factories can further enhance their appeal to this demographic.
